Free agency thus far for Packers:

Free agent departures:
  • Willis - Dolphinss 3 yrs $67.5M
  • Enagbare - Jets 1 yr $10M
  • Doubs - Patriots 4 yrs $70M
  • Q. Walker - Raiders 3 yrs $40.5M
  • Z. Anderson - Dolphins
No news on R. Walker yet

Other departures:
  • Gary traded to Cowboys for 4th round pick
  • Wooden traded to Colts for LB Franklin
  • Jenkins released
  • Hobbs released post June 1st cut

Resigned:
  • Rhyan C
  • Whyle TE
  • Kinnard OL
  • Brooks RB
  • Ford DT
  • Cox Edge
  • Welch LB
  • Niemann LB

Free agent signings:
  • St-Juste CB Chargers 2 yrs $10M
  • Sky Moore WR/KR 1 yr $2.5M
  • Hargrave DT Vikings 2 yrs $23M

Packers trade Wicks to Eagles for 5th round pick this year and a 6th next year.

Leaves Watson, Reed, Golden as top 3... also with S. Williams, Sky Moore and Bo Melton.

The Packers received a fifth-round pick in this year's draft and a sixth-rounder next year.

Wicks' agent, David Mulugheta, told ESPN's Adam Schefter that the Eagles are signing Wicks to a one-year, $12.5 million extension. Philadelphia announced the trade and an agreement on the one-year extension Saturday without disclosing the value.

Wicks was heading into the final year of his rookie contract but now is under contract through the 2027 season.
A fifth-round pick in 2023, Wicks caught 30 passes for 332 yards and a pair of touchdowns last season.
